1. 3 3 AC System W N N f 1 P E AGH LR i a Q Q Q Q A1 A2 KE ISOLR275 AGH LR Installation Bulletin Reference Guide Wiring Multiple isoPV Devices in Arrays with a Common Bus Only one isoLR275 detector at a time may be online and measuring in a complete isolated system Circuits connected to a common bus which may or may not be connected simultane ously require special connections in order to ensure that only one device is on at a time These requirements may be accomplished in one of two ways e Option 1 Connecting each device s F1 F2 standby terminals and manually controlling the switching with control logic e Option 2 Automating the switching by connecting each device together via RS 485 For option 1 closing the F1 F2 terminal set puts the device into standby mode Using control logic from the tiebreaker will allow for manual control to ensure that only one device is on when the tiebreaker is closed Option 2 automates the process Complete the following steps 1 Connect each isoLR275 in series with each other via the A and B terminals Use RS 485 cable 2 The devices at the beginning and the end of the chain require activating the termination resistor Switch the Ron DIP switch to ON 3 Each device requires a unique communication address Under the menu option COM SETUP gt Addr set one device to address 1 Set the address for each other device seque

7. tiates self test moves up in menu 3 RESET DOWN key Resets device when latching mode is active moves down in menu 4 MENU ENTER key Opens the main menu confirms changes in menu Device Setup Tips LED ALARM 1 IIluminates when alarm 1 is active LED ALARM 2 IIluminates when alarm 2 is active LED ERROR Illuminates when a device error has occured Ensure that all menu options in red in the menu structure flow chart are set correctly Incorrect settings may lead to improper readings For alarm trip values use the factory defaults when possible The optimal measuring principle under menu option ISO ADVANCED gt Measure has been factory set for large low resistance ungrounded systems Refer to isoLR275 user manual for more information on this setting Options ISO SETUP gt K1 and ISO SETUP gt K2 refer to the energized state of the output relays K1 and K2 during operation Refer to the section Wiring Contacts on the re verse side of this document for more information The menu options stand for e N C Normally energized operation failsafe mode e N O Normally deenergized operation nonfailsafe mode e N C T Normally energized operation switches during self test e N O T Normally deenergized operation switches during self test Flash During alarm contact switches app every 2 seconds Analog Outputs IsoLR275 models feature a 0 20 mA or 4 20 mA output selecta
